Liquidation Threshold Navigation represents a dynamic process within cryptocurrency derivatives markets, focused on preemptively managing exposure to potential cascading liquidations. It involves continuously assessing an account’s margin ratio relative to predefined thresholds established by exchanges, factoring in real-time price fluctuations and volatility estimates. Effective implementation necessitates a quantitative approach, utilizing models to predict the probability of margin calls and proactively adjusting position sizes or employing hedging strategies. This algorithmic approach aims to minimize the impact of adverse market movements on capital preservation, particularly crucial in highly leveraged trading scenarios.
